Ramp Agent
3 weeks ago
This is an interview position.
Coordinates all operations relating to aircraft loading/unloading activities; provides leadership to cargo handlers and operational and personnel support. May perform job duties and responsibilities required of a courier, cargo handler and/or dispatcher. To model the way for hourly employees by becoming a mentor and demonstrating role model behaviour including strong communication, conflict resolution and leadership ability (through Best Practices methods)
RE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ES
High school/educational equivalent
Six (6) months experience/training in jet aircraft ground support equipment/aircraft operations
Demonstrated proficiency in basic level MS Word and Excel
Ability to prepare and process Canadian customs paperwork
Ability to successfully complete all required basic training and maintain accreditation through yearly recurrency training, i.e. GSE administrator and operator permit, DG Specialist certified, W&B certification, etc.
Good understanding of FedEx products, features of service, general operations. Loading/unloading procedures preferred
Must have the ability to lift 70 lbs and manoeuvre any package weighing up to 150 lbs with appropriate equipment
Must possess a valid driver's licence and good driving record
Excellent human relations, customer relations, and communication skills
Good analytical, problem solving, prioritization and organizational skills
Must be able to pass R.C.M.P. assessment.
